NVIDIA has unveiled a new line of artificial intelligence processors, targeting the personal computer market. This move signifies a direct push to integrate AI capabilities deeper into everyday computing devices, moving beyond servers and specialized hardware. The company's announcement centers on bringing advanced AI functionalities directly to the user's desktop and laptop experiences.
The chips are designed to handle AI tasks locally, potentially reducing reliance on cloud-based processing. This could translate to faster AI application performance and enhanced user privacy, as sensitive data may no longer need to be transmitted externally. Further details regarding specific chip models, performance benchmarks, and anticipated release timelines remain scant, leaving the exact impact and accessibility for consumers and professionals yet to be fully defined.

For users of NVIDIA's existing hardware, particularly on Linux systems, the company offers driver updates. While many Linux distributions provide their own NVIDIA graphics driver packages that may offer better system integration, NVIDIA also offers direct updates for its components. This includes notifications for the latest driver versions, enabling one-click updates without leaving the user's current environment. The company differentiates between drivers suited for professionals and workstations, such as the 'Enterprise Production Branch driver', which is a rebranded 'Quadro Optimal Driver for Enterprise (ODE)', and drivers offering access to newer features, bug fixes, and operating system support—often termed the 'New Feature Branch (NFB)' or 'Quadro New Feature (QNF)'. For most users prioritizing stability and performance, the 'Production Branch/Studio' drivers are typically recommended. Corporate clients with current vGPU software licenses have access to specialized download portals for specific enterprise solutions like GRID vPC, GRID vApps, or Quadro vDWS.
